Mission & Design Goal


To create an empathetic fertility tracking experience that empowers users of all backgrounds to understand their reproductive health without stigma or complexity.


Design a dual wearable system that feels private, approachable, and clinically trustworthy - transforming fertility tracking into a seamless, emotionally supportive daily habit.

Solution Design

The design system prioritizes privacy, clarity, and inclusivity, featuring glanceable insights, one-hand navigation, and calm visual cues that fit naturally into everyday life. Every interface decision balances clinical accuracy with emotional sensitivity, ensuring technology feels human-centered and reassuring.

Future Design Challenges

As FertiliSense evolves beyond fertility tracking into a comprehensive reproductive health platform, new design challenges emerge - that scale across life stages, devices, and cultures:


Creating global design systems that can localize content, tone, and visuals for international users without losing brand


Building privacy-first telehealth interactions that feel personal and reassuring, even when mediated through screens and wearable data.


Designing for shared use — exploring how partners, clinicians, and caregivers can safely and meaningfully engage without compromising user privacy.
